Latest Patents

Kitani's latest patents showcase his ingenuity in developing advanced welding equipment. The first patent is for a consumable electrode type arc welding apparatus that enables reliable arcing under diverse welding conditions. This apparatus incorporates a start current detector that selects a predetermined limited start current, along with a start current period setting unit that adjusts the start current period based on specific welding factors. The start current control circuit then delivers this limited start current to both the workpiece and the wire electrode during the initial phase of arcing.

The second patent addresses an arc blowing control method and apparatus specifically designed for pulse arc welding systems. This invention aims to prevent the extinction of the welding arc in fluctuating current scenarios, thereby mitigating spattering of molten welding materials and ensuring a smooth, continuous welding bead. It includes a detection circuit that identifies the occurrence of a stepped leader phenomenon during pulse arc welding, which generates a corresponding stepped leader signal. A switching unit uses this signal to toggle between normal arc signal output and an arc blowing blocking signal output, which is critical in enhancing welding effectiveness.
